Answer:
A. Similar using SAS; ∆ABC ~ ∆DFE
Step-by-step explanation:
m<B of ∆ABC = m<F of ∆DFE
AB corresponds to DF
AB/DF = 12/8 = 3/2
BC corresponds to FE
BC/FE = 24/16 = 3/2
Thus, the ratio of the corresponding sides of both triangles are the same. Therefore, both triangles has two sides that are proportional to each other, and also had an included corresponding angles that are congruent to each other.
By the SAS criterion, we can conclude that both triangles are similar to each other. That is, ∆ABC ~ ∆DFE
Answer:
Independent variable: amount of water
Dependent variable: growth of the plant
Step-by-step explanation:
In the statement "Julie notices that her plant grows one inch for every liter of water that it receives" it is implied that the growth of the plant is related proportionally to the amount of water it receives.
We know the amount of growth in function of the amount of water
The dependant variable, the result, is the growth of the plant.
Then, the independent variable is the amount of water, as it is the input to calculate the amount of growth.
